- the invention relates to a device for delivering fuel to one Internal combustion engine with the features mentioned in the preamble of the main claim.
- a generic device for is known from the document DE 195 13 822 A1 Conveying fuel from a fuel tank to an internal combustion engine Motor vehicle.
- the facility consists essentially of a Internal combustion powered feed pump, which is designed as a gear pump and is connected to the fuel tank via a delivery line. This Gear pump delivers the fuel to the injection system of the internal combustion engine.
- the feed pump forms an assembly together with an air-conveying pump, whose suction side to generate a negative pressure with a brake booster Motor vehicle is connected.
- the fuel supply is also previously known from document DE 196 12 605 A1 an internal combustion engine by means of a fuel-flushed and in the fuel tank to accommodate housed electric motor-driven feed pump.
- the feed pump is located in a storage pot also arranged in the fuel tank Operatively connected. In the lower area of this storage pot there is a separate one Liquid jet pump, via which the storage pot is filled and regulated becomes.
- a second additional pump is provided for the fuel supply described above Securing funding after the fuel tank runs empty is necessary, too deviates from the usual pump types in motor vehicle construction.
- the invention has for its object a generic feed pump in terms improve their suction behavior after emptying the fuel tank while doing so to achieve self-venting.
- the object of the invention is achieved by the in the characterizing part of Features mentioned claims.
- the advantages of the invention are in the optimal design of the pump unit with a pressure side Storage pot. Even after the fuel tank is empty, it is quick Fuel delivery with simultaneous ventilation, so a quick engine start is possible.
- the features of the subclaims are related to the description their effects explained.
- Fig. 1 are essential parts of the fuel supply of an internal combustion engine shown schematically.
- a feed pump 1 driven by the internal combustion engine sucks fuel from a fuel tank 5 and first fills a storage pot 3 which vented at the same time.
- a check valve 7 Located in the suction line 6 of the feed pump 1 a check valve 7 opening in the direction of the fuel pump 1, it prevents this Sucked fuel falls back into the fuel tank 5.
- One or more fuel pressure lines 2a are above the feed pump 1 Storage pot 3 connected (Fig. 2 and 3), they feed an injection pump or Pump-nozzle elements with fuel (both not shown). Not the one Internal combustion engine from the injection pump or the pump-nozzle elements supplied fuel flows through a return line 8 and a pre-pressure valve 9 in the Fuel tank 5 back.
- the storage pot 3 axially covers the area of the feed pump 1 and part of the adjacent sealing limits (Fig. 2 and 3).
- the ones that form the sealing limits, for example seals 10 consisting of round rings are located in the area of the storage pot 3 in constant contact with fuel over a large part of its extent.
- A is preferably at the highest point of the storage pot 3 Pressure relief valve 11 connected. This pressure relief valve 11 opens at higher pressure than the pre-pressure valve 9. The return of fuel takes place via the Pressure relief valve 11 and a return line 12 to the suction side of the feed pump 1.

- Einrichtung zum Fördern von Kraftstoff zu einem Verbrennungsmotor mit einer Förderpumpe zum Speisen einer Einspritzanlage, die als vorzugsweise direkt aus dem Kraftstofftank fördernde und vom Verbrennungsmotor angetriebene Zahnrad- oder Flügelzellenpumpe ausgeführt ist,
dadurch gekennzeichnet, daß der Förderpumpe (1) druckseitig ein Speichertopf (3) nachgeschaltet ist, wobei eine Kraftstoffzulaufleitung (2a) bzw. Kraftstoffzulaufleitungen zur Einspritzanlage oberhalb der Förderpumpe (1) am Speichertopf (3) angeschlossen ist bzw. sind. - Einrichtung nach Anspruch 1,
dadurch gekennzeichnet, daß der Speichertopf (3) axial den Bereich der Förderpumpe (1) und einen Teil der anliegenden Dichtgrenzen überdeckt. - Einrichtung nach Anspruch 1,
dadurch gekennzeichnet, daß ein Druckbegrenzungsventil (11) vorzugsweise an der höchsten Stelle des Speichertopfes (3) angeschlossen ist. - Einrichtung nach Anspruch 3,
dadurch gekennzeichnet, daß das Druckbegrenzungsventil (11) über eine Kraftstoffrücklaufleitung (12) mit der Saugseite der Förderpumpe (1) verbunden ist. - Einrichtung nach Anspruch 1,
dadurch gekennzeichnet, daß in der Saugleitung (6) der Förderpumpe (1) ein den Rücklauf von angesaugtem Kraftstoff verhinderndes Rückschlagventil (7) angeordnet ist.
